Abstract
- The article considers the role of traditional ecological knowledge (TEK), the generally accepted information and beliefs of a specific society about its environmental conditions and ecosystem use, in environmental policy formation in Europe. A relative lack of research on TEK within European rural communities is noted. Forestry management is among the examples cited of an environmental issue in which TEK could implement sustainable resource management.
